如何在CentOS / RHEL上使用RVM安装Ruby 2.4.0

可以在带有RVM的CentOS / RHEL上安装Ruby 2.4.0。本教程将帮助您在CentOS和RedHat系统上安装Ruby 2.4.0。

Ruby 2.4.0发布 ,Ruby是一种面向对象的动态编程语言,专注于简单性和生产力。 RVM(Ruby Version Manager)是一种在单个操作系统上安装和管理多个Ruby版本的工具。本教程将帮助您在系统上安装RVM。之后在CentOS上安装Ruby 2.4.0,RedHat系统使用RVM。

步骤1.安装需求

首先,我们需要使用以下命令在我们的系统上安装所有需要的ruby安装包。
# yum install gcc-c++ patch readline readline-devel zlib zlib-devel
# yum install libyaml-devel libffi-devel openssl-devel make
# yum install bzip2 autoconf automake libtool bison iconv-devel sqlite-devel
步骤2.安装RVM
使用以下命令在系统上安装最新稳定版本的RVM。此命令将自动下载所有所需的文件并在系统上安装。
# curl -sSL https://rvm.io/mpapis.asc | gpg --import -
# curl -L get.rvm.io | bash -s stable
此外,运行以下命令加载rvm环境。
# source /etc/profile.d/rvm.sh
# rvm reload
步骤3.验证依赖关系
现在使用以下命令验证所有依赖项是否已正确安装。
# rvm requirements run

Checking requirements for centos.
Requirements installation successful.
步骤4.安装Ruby 2.4
完成RVM环境设置后,可以使用以下命令安装Ruby语言。
# rvm install 2.4.0
[样品输出]
Searching for binary rubies, this might take some time.
Found remote file https://rvm_io.global.ssl.fastly.net/binaries/ubuntu/16.04/x86_64/ruby-2.4.0.tar.bz2
Checking requirements for ubuntu.
Requirements installation successful.
ruby-2.4.0 - #configure
ruby-2.4.0 - #download
  % Total    % Received % Xferd  Average Speed   Time    Time     Time  Current
                                 Dload  Upload   Total   Spent    Left  Speed
100 16.4M  100 16.4M    0     0   724k      0  0:00:23  0:00:23 --:--:--  790k
No checksum for downloaded archive, recording checksum in user configuration.
ruby-2.4.0 - #validate archive
ruby-2.4.0 - #extract
ruby-2.4.0 - #validate binary
ruby-2.4.0 - #setup
ruby-2.4.0 - #gemset created /usr/local/rvm/gems/ruby-2.4.0@global
ruby-2.4.0 - #importing gemset /usr/local/rvm/gemsets/global.gems..............................
ruby-2.4.0 - #generating global wrappers........
ruby-2.4.0 - #gemset created /usr/local/rvm/gems/ruby-2.4.0
ruby-2.4.0 - #importing gemsetfile /usr/local/rvm/gemsets/default.gems evaluated to empty gem list
ruby-2.4.0 - #generating default wrappers........
步骤5.设置默认Ruby版本
首先,检查系统上当前安装的ruby版本。所以我们可以通过系统当前使用哪个版本,并将其设置为默认值。
# rvm list

rvm rubies

 * ruby-2.3.0 [ x86_64 ]
   ruby-2.3.3 [ x86_64 ]
=> ruby-2.4.0 [ x86_64 ]

# => - current
# =* - current && default
#  * - default
之后,使用rvm命令设置应用程序使用的默认ruby版本。
# rvm use 2.4.0 --default

Using /usr/local/rvm/gems/ruby-2.4.0
步骤6.检查当前Ruby版本。
使用以下命令可以检查当前使用的ruby版本。
# ruby --version

ruby 2.4.0p0 (2016-12-24 revision 57164) [x86_64-linux]
祝贺,最后,你已经成功地在你的系统上安装了Ruby。阅读我们的下一篇文章,通过简单的步骤将Ruby与Apache Web服务器集成参考文献: http://rvm.io/rubies/installing